Discovery, structure revision, synthesis, and application of all known and even unknown securingine alkaloids
Abstract
Covering: up to 2025
Natural product-based research encompasses the discovery, structure elucidation, biosynthesis, synthesis, and application of naturally occurring secondary metabolites. Securingine alkaloids, isolated from Flueggea suffruticosa, have emerged as valuable molecular frameworks for exploring various aspects of natural product research due to their distinct chemical structures, characterized by unique oxidation and rearrangement patterns. Herein, we provide a comprehensive account of our journey in developing novel synthetic strategies and tactics for accessing all known and even unknown securingines and investigating the potential application of securingine B as a novel class of natural product-based molecular photoswitches.
